Confirmed: 7 players to leave Gor Mahia

Image result for tusiyenge

Kenyan Premier League giants Gor Mahia are set to release seven players ahead of the 2019-20 season. This was confirmed by the club’s Chief Executive Officer Lodvick Aduda.

The seven players include;

1. Castro Ogendo – midfielder
2. Erisa Ssekisambu – forward
3. Pascal Ogweno – central defender
4. Cercidy Okeyo – central midfielder
5. Shaban Odhoji – goalkeeper
6. Francis Kahata – attacking midfielder
7. Jacques Tuyisenge – forward

Midfielder Francis Kahata had already moved to the Tanzanian side Simba SC on a free transfer after the expiry of his contract with K’Ogalo.

The Rwandese sensational Jacques Tuyisenge has also been confirmed to be concluding their negotiation with the Angolan giants Petro Atlético de Luanda. Gor and the Angolan club have agreed on terms of the deal.

K’Ogalo have also confirmed the signing of several players this transfer period. The newcomers include; Tobias Otieno and Abadalla Shira from Sony Sugar, Elvis Ronack from Nzoia Sugar, Dennis Oalo and Curtis Wekesa from Nairobi Stima, David Kissu from Singida United and winger Dickson Ambundo from Alliance FC among others.
